Anyone replace their knock sensors?
Well just had the beast dyno- tuned again after a head and intake install. Made 400rwhp with cats and the car feels very strong but I'm getting 4*kr at 4000rpm.Racing gas was used and no help.Reinstalled stock pulley,again no help.That leads me to the sensors.Can someone give me the part # for the newer sensors being used or any insight into this problem? Re: Anyone replace their knock sensors?
According to the parts manual the 98 has 2 possibilities.
10456603 – KS w/o locating tab
10456222 – KS with locating tab
10456603 is what is used on 99 and up.
